2009 Season Highlights
 Terry Kenimer enters his 5th season as Head Coach at Pisgah.
 The Eagles finished 3rd in Region 6.

Great Moments in Alabama High School Football History

In 1925 Langdale tied a record by defeating Milltown 125-0. Hamilton had set the record by thrashing Fayette 125-0 in 1915.
